/* CSS Document */

* {
	margin:0; padding:0;
	font-size:100%;
}

body{
	background: url(images/bg1.gif);
	font-family: Arial, Helvetica, sans-serif;
	font-size: 100%;
	line-height: 1.5;
}

html, input, textarea
	{
	font-family: Arial, Helvetica, sans-serif;
	font-size:0.8125em;
	line-height:1.6cm;
	color:#A29B8A;
	}

.left { float:left;}
.right {float:right;}
.clear  { clear:both;}
.aligncenter { text-align:center;}
.alignleft { text-align:left;}
.alignright { text-align:right;}


input, select { vertical-align:middle; font-weight:normal;}
a { color:#FFF; outline:none; text-decoration:underline;}
a:hover{
	text-decoration:none;
	font-family: Tahoma, Geneva, sans-serif;
	color: #000;
}
p {
	padding-top:15px;
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 14px;
	color: #A29B8A;
}
a img { border:0;}
ul { list-style:none;}
img {vertical-align:top;}

h3 {
	font-size:24px;
	line-height:1.2em;
	padding:2px 0 10px 0;
	color:#F90;
	font-family: "Palatino Linotype", "Book Antiqua", Palatino, serif;
	font-weight: bold;
}

.link1 { background:url(images/marker.gif) right 5px no-repeat; padding-right:11px; font-size:0.846em; font-weight:bold; text-decoration:none; text-transform:uppercase; color:#FAB300;}
.link1:hover {
	text-decoration:underline;
	font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size: 0.846em;
}

object { outline:none;}

.color1 {
	color:#F90;
	font-family: "Palatino Linotype", "Book Antiqua", Palatino, serif;
	font-weight: bold;
	text-align: center;
	font-size: 24px;
}
.color2 {
	color:#85C91C;
	font-family: "Palatino Linotype", "Book Antiqua", Palatino, serif;
	font-weight: bold;
}
.color3 {
	color:#FE6E21;
	font-family: "Palatino Linotype", "Book Antiqua", Palatino, serif;
	font-weight: bold;
}
.color4 { color:#D3CEC4;}

/* ============================= main layout ====================== */
.main { width:960px; margin:0 auto; text-align:left;}

.imgindent { float:left; margin-right:20px;}
.indent1 { padding-left:30px;}
.indent2 { padding-right:15px;}
.space1 { margin-left:30px;}
.space2 { margin-right:133px;}
.space3 { margin-top:25px;}
.space4 { margin-top:15px;}
.space5 { margin-right:35px;}

/* ============================= content ====================== */
#content { padding:18px 0 25px; }
.box {
	background:url(images/bg10.gif);
	line-height:1.6em;
	color:#001;
	padding:12px 0 16px 30px;
}
.separator { background:url(images/separator.gif) left repeat-y;}
.button3 {
	display:inline-block;
	background:url(images/button3-tail.gif) top repeat-x;
	font-weight:bold;
	font-size:0.7em;
	line-height:0.7em;
	color:#000;
	text-decoration:none;
}
.button3 strong { display:inline-block; background:url(images/button3-left.gif) top left no-repeat; cursor:pointer;}
.button3 strong strong {
	height:20px;
	background:url(images/button3-right.gif) top right no-repeat;
	padding:9px 13px 0;
	font-family: Tahoma, Geneva, sans-serif;
	font-size: 10pt;
	line-height: normal;
	text-decoration: underline;
}
.button3:hover {
	color:#000;
	font-size: 16pt;
	font-style: normal;
	line-height: normal;
	font-weight: normal;
	font-variant: normal;
	text-transform: none;
	cursor: crosshair;
	filter: Gray;
}
.column-bg { background:url(images/bg11.gif);}

dl dt { padding-bottom:5px; font-weight:bold;}
dl dt strong { color:#EDE8D2;}

.list1 {
	line-height:1.615em;
	font-size: 14px;
	font-family: Arial, Helvetica, sans-serif;
}
.list1 li a { background:url(images/marker.gif) 0 6px no-repeat; padding-left:14px; color:#F9AB00; font-weight:bold; text-decoration:none;}
.list1 li a:hover { color:#FFF; }

.phone { float:left; width:100px;}

#page1 .column-1 {
	width:273px;
	text-align: center;
}
#page1 .column-2 {
	width:277px;
	font-size: 14px;
	text-align: center;
	font-family: Tahoma, Geneva, sans-serif;
}
#page1 .column-3 {
	width:275px;
	text-align: center;
}

#page1 .column-4 { width:640px;}
#page1 .column-4 .indent {
	padding:30px 50px 35px 10px;
	font-size: 18px;
}
#page1 .column-5 { width:320px;}
#page1 .column-5 .indent { padding:30px 35px 35px 30px;}
#page1 .col-1 {
	width:300px;
	font-size: 14px;
}
#page1 .col-2 { width:250px;}


#page2 #content { padding:8px 0 25px; }
#page2 .column-4 { width:640px;}
#page2 .column-4 .indent { padding:25px 35px 25px 30px;}
#page2 .column-5 { width:320px;}
#page2 .column-5 .indent { padding:25px 35px 25px 30px;}

#page2 .column-1 { width:273px;}
#page2 .column-2 { width:580px;}
#page2 .col-1 { width:300px;}
#page2 .col-2 { width:250px;}


#page3 .column-1 { width:273px;}
#page3 .column-2 { width:277px;}
#page3 .column-3 { width:275px;}

#page3 .column-4 { width:640px;}
#page3 .column-4 .indent { padding:30px 50px 35px 10px;}
#page3 .column-5 { width:320px;}
#page3 .column-5 .indent { padding:30px 35px 35px 30px;}


#page4 #content { padding:8px 0 25px; }
#page4 .column-4 { width:640px;}
#page4 .column-4 .indent { padding:25px 35px 25px 30px;}
#page4 .column-5 { width:320px;}
#page4 .column-5 .indent { padding:25px 35px 25px 30px;}
#page4 .col-1 { width:280px;}
#page4 .col-2 { width:270px;}

#page4 .column-1 {
	width:273px;
	color: #A29B8A;
}
#page4 .column-2 { width:580px;}
#page4 .col-3 { width:270px;}
#page4 .col-4 { width:270px;}


#page5 .column-1 {
	width:800;
	color: #A29B8A;
	font-size: 18px;
	text-align: left;
}
#page5 .column-2 {
	width:290px;
	font-size: 18px;
	text-align: left;
	color: #A29B8A;
}
#page5 .col-1 { width:290px;}
#page5 .col-2 { width:275px;}

#page5 .column-4 { width:640px;}
#page5 .column-4 .indent { padding:30px 50px 35px 10px;}
#page5 .column-5 { width:320px;}
#page5 .column-5 .indent { padding:30px 35px 35px 30px;}
#page5 .column-5 { color:#D3CEC4;}

#page6 #content { padding:30px 0 60px; }
#page6 h3 { padding-bottom:25px;}
#page6 #content .indent { padding:0 40px 0 10px;}




/* ============================= footer ====================== */
#footer { background:url(images/bg8.gif);}
#footer .bg-top {height:126px; background:url(images/bg9.gif) top repeat-x;}
#footer .indent { padding:28px 0 0 26px;}
#footer a { color:#FFF; text-decoration:none;}
#footer a:hover { text-decoration:underline;}
/* ============================= forms ============================= */
#ContactForm {line-height:1.4em;}
label { height:60px; display:block;} 
#ContactForm input {width:257px; height:18px; border:1px solid #A29B8A; background:#181211; padding:5px 0 3px 5px; font-size:1em; line-height:1em;}
#ContactForm textarea {width:267px; height:144px; border:1px solid #A29B8A; background:#181211; padding:2px 0 0 5px; overflow:auto; font-size:1em; line-height:1em;}
